1.2 Category Snapshot

Anti-fog eyeglass wipes are pre-moistened cleaning products primarily used for quickly removing dust, stains, and fingerprints from glasses, sunglasses, goggles, and various electronic screens (e.g., phones, computers, camera lenses). Their core selling point is the claimed anti-fog effect in addition to basic cleaning. Products are typically individually packaged, emphasizing portability and streak-free cleaning, aiming to meet users' immediate needs for clear vision across different scenarios. 3.4 Unmet Needs & Market Gaps

  • Stable & Long-lasting Anti-Fog: The market generally lacks products that deliver stable, long-lasting anti-fog effects; users harbor doubts and dissatisfaction with existing anti-fog wipes' performance.
    User Reviews (VOC)
    Customers have mixed experiences with the anti-fog wipes: while some report they prevent fogging significantly and work great, others say they don't work at all. // I bought this just for the Anti-fog. It was for my safety glasses at work. The anti-fog DOES NOT WORK AT ALL.
  • Eliminate Residue/Streaks: Many users complain about streaks, film, or smudges left after wiping, affecting final clarity-a persistent problem requiring urgent resolution.
    User Reviews (VOC)
    Customers have mixed experiences with streaking: while some report that the wipes clean without leaving any streaks, others mention that they leave streaks on their glasses. // These wipes don't dry very well and leave steaks no matter how much you try to get clear vision.
  • Consistent Wipe Moisture Level: Users frequently encounter wipes that are too dry or too wet, directly impacting cleaning effectiveness and user experience, necessitating improved production quality control.
    User Reviews (VOC)
    Customers have mixed opinions about the wipes' moisture level, with some finding them moist enough while others say they're too dry. // Sometimes, I have to let the wipe dry out a little before I use them as they are too moist. Other times, I need to add a little water.
  • Wipe Size Compatibility: Some wipes are too small, requiring multiple pieces for large glasses or screens; users desire better-sized options.
    User Reviews (VOC)
    So tiny you need at least two for one pair of regular eyeglasses. // Wipes are very small. Need at least 2 to clean my glasses

VI. Market Fit Analysis

6.1 Alignment Analysis

In this niche category of anti-fog eyeglass wipes, we observe a significant misalignment between seller promotion and actual buyer needs and experiences.

First, a focus misalignment: Sellers commonly position the 'anti-fog function' as the core selling point and key differentiator, heavily emphasizing in product titles and bullet points that the anti-fog effect lasts for hours or even days. However, a substantial volume of user reviews indicates that the product's anti-fog performance fails to live up to its claims, with many users reporting glasses still fogging up post-use and anti-fog duration falling far short of advertised promises. This suggests sellers are 'over-promising' in marketing without delivering sufficiently stable product performance to back it up, leading to consumer disappointment regarding the core need to 'prevent fogging'. Concurrently, 'wipe moisture consistency' is a frequently mentioned pain point-some wipes are too dry, lacking cleaning power; others are too wet, prone to leaving streaks. Yet, sellers rarely proactively mention or emphasize their quality control and optimization in this area in their promotions, masking this high-frequency user issue with marketing rhetoric.

Second, a factual misalignment: Some products' claims of 'long-lasting anti-fog' may be at odds with actual physical and chemical principles. For instance, a simple pre-moistened alcohol wipe reliably preventing fog for 24 hours or even 3 days under complex conditions like high heat, humidity, and drastic temperature swings-without affecting lens transparency or coatings-poses technical challenges. If the formula is too potent, it may damage lens coatings; if too mild, the anti-fog effect may be limited. Frequent user complaints about anti-fog ineffectiveness likely reveal that marketing promises have exceeded the actual performance ceiling achievable with current product technology or cost constraints. Furthermore, wipes being 'too dry' in unopened packages directly conflicts with claims of being 'pre-moistened' and 'individually packaged to retain moisture', indicating shortcomings in the supply chain or packaging seal technology rather than simple user usage variations.
